Regular Season Round 11: Kings - Taipans 98-109

Date: December 8, 2019
Very important is a home loss of first ranked Kings (11-3) against sixth ranked Cairns Taipans (7-7) on Sunday night. Host Kings were defeated by Cairns Taipans in Sydney 109-98. Cairns Taipans made 23-of-26 charity shots (88.5 percent) during the game. They shot the lights out from three nailing 14 long-distance shots on high 53.8 percentage. Kings were plagued by 24 personal fouls down the stretch. It was an exceptional evening for Brazilian-American guard Scott Machado (186-90, college: Iona) who led the winners and scored 21 points, 7 rebounds and 9 assists. American guard DJ Newbill (193-92, college: Penn St.) accounted for 31 points (was perfect 9-for-9 from the free throw line !!!) for the winning side. American point guard Casper Ware (178-90, college: LBSU) came up with 23 points and 7 assists and the former international center Andrew Bogut (213-84, college: Utah) added 12 points and 12 rebounds respectively for Kings in the defeat. Both teams had five players each who scored in double figures. Kings' coach Will Weaver rotated ten players in this game, but that didn't help. Cairns Taipans have a solid series of three victories in a row. They moved-up to fourth place. Kings at the other side still keep top position with three games lost. Cairns Taipans will play against Melbourne Phoenix (#5) in Melbourne, Victoria in the next round. Kings will play on the road against United (#3) in Melbourne and it may be a tough game between close rivals.
